Summary
A Roman silver coin found in a garden, identified as a quinarius of the Emperor Allectus (293-296).

Full Description
SY 63229961. A quinarius of Allectus was found by Mr C A Witlock in the garden of the Greyhound Inn, and notified by Mr J R Bradshaw. <1>
